The cinematic world was forever changed in 2004 when Mel Gibson released The Passion of the Christ . A brutal, beautiful, and controversial depiction of the final twelve hours of Jesus of Nazareth’s life, the film became a global phenomenon. Now, over two decades later, the anticipation for its sequel has reached a fever pitch. Tentatively titled The Passion of the Christ: Resurrection (or The Passion of the Christ 2 ), this follow-up promises to explore the three days between Christ’s crucifixion and His ascension. the passion of the christ resurrection download
